System zarządzania oknami czasowymi we Flasku #2

Kod źródłowy aplikacji do pobrania – tutaj.

Aplikację można wypróbować tutaj.

Plan aplikacji opisanej we wcześniejszym artykule wygląda następująco:

├───flask_contracts
│ ├───api
│ ├───auth
│ │ ├───static
│ │ │ └───logos
│ │ ├───templates
│ │ │ └───auth
│ │ ├───utils
│ │ │ ├───templates
│ │ │ │ └───utils
│ ├───contracts
│ │ ├───static
│ │ ├───templates
│ │ │ └───contracts
│ │ │ └───errors
│ │ ├───utils
│ ├───static
│ ├───templates
├───tests
│ ├───functional
│ ├───unit
└───venv

Każda część aplikacji jest osobną całością. Podobne rozwiązanie jest zastosowane w Django. Do zarządzania aplikacją napisałem plik manage.py. Każda część składowa posiada własne podkatalogi szablonów – konwencja podobna do obecnej w Django.

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*